Cloud-based collaboration tools

from class:

Multinational Corporate Strategies

Definition

Cloud-based collaboration tools are digital platforms that allow individuals and teams to work together on projects, share information, and communicate in real-time through the internet. These tools enhance teamwork by enabling easy access to shared resources, improving coordination among global teams, and fostering communication across different geographical locations.

5 Must Know Facts For Your Next Test

  1. Cloud-based collaboration tools eliminate the need for physical presence, making it easier for multinational teams to coordinate and share information seamlessly.
  2. These tools can integrate various functions such as document sharing, messaging, video conferencing, and task management all in one platform.
  3. Examples of popular cloud-based collaboration tools include Google Workspace, Microsoft Teams, and Slack, which are widely used in global supply chain operations.
  4. Security features in these tools are crucial as they protect sensitive data while allowing easy access for authorized team members.
  5. Adopting cloud-based collaboration tools can significantly reduce operational costs by minimizing the need for physical infrastructure and facilitating efficient remote work.

Review Questions

  • How do cloud-based collaboration tools enhance teamwork among multinational teams?
    • Cloud-based collaboration tools enhance teamwork among multinational teams by providing a centralized platform where members can communicate, share files, and manage tasks in real time. This facilitates better coordination and allows team members from different locations to contribute equally regardless of time zones. With these tools, teams can break down geographical barriers, leading to more effective collaboration and faster project completion.
  • Evaluate the impact of security features in cloud-based collaboration tools on global supply chains.
    • The security features in cloud-based collaboration tools play a critical role in protecting sensitive information shared within global supply chains. These features ensure that data is encrypted during transmission and that access is restricted to authorized personnel only. By safeguarding proprietary data and communication channels, companies can maintain trust with their partners and clients while minimizing the risk of data breaches that could disrupt supply chain operations.
  • Assess how the integration of cloud-based collaboration tools with project management software can transform operational efficiency in multinational corporations.
    • The integration of cloud-based collaboration tools with project management software can significantly transform operational efficiency in multinational corporations by streamlining communication and task management processes. This synergy allows for real-time updates on project progress, immediate feedback on tasks, and centralized storage of project documents. As a result, teams can respond swiftly to changes and challenges, enhancing overall productivity while reducing delays that may arise from traditional methods of project execution.
